Summary/Abstract: In the challenging environment of the new age, in the field of competition in the markets, one of the components that increase success for companies is to focus on the task of strategic human resource management (HRM), which gives the company a competitive advantage. In the meantime, human resources are more important due to their limitations and information resources due to their importance in making correct decisions. The objective of this study is to analyze the relationship between human resources management and financial productivity and employee performance of current companies in the stock market of Uzbekistan in 2023. Descriptive and inferential statistics from SPSS software were used for data analysis. In this research, 255 people completed the questionnaire completely. The present study showed that there is a positive and high correlation between strategic planning of human resources and employee performance, and with the increase of strategic planning of human resources in the organization, the level of employee performance and therefore the financial efficiency of the company also increases.
